Genealogical research on the last name Agha-badalian

The surname Agha Badalian likely has Persian or Armenian origins. The name Agha is of Persian and Turkish origin, meaning "chief" or "master", while Badalian is an Armenian surname indicating a connection to the region of Badal, which is located in modern-day Armenia. The combination of these two names suggests a possible mix of Persian and Armenian ancestry. The surname Agha Badalian may have been passed down through generations, indicating a familial connection to both Persian and Armenian cultures.
